Cairo – Canal Shipping Agencies denied news reports about its merger with other shipping agencies.

Reports about initiating procedures to merge with Abu Simbel and Thebes Shipping Agencies Co, Amon Shipping Agency, and Memphis Shipping Agencies Co. are incorrect, the company said in a statement to the Egyptian Exchange (EGX) on Tuesday.

The Holding Company for Maritime and Land Transport affirmed that the reports on the merger are baseless.

It is noteworthy that during the first half of fiscal year 2019/2020, Canal Shipping Agencies reported net profits of EGP 161.99 million, compared to EGP 123.43 million in the prior-year period.
